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"obduct" in English
English translation for "
obduct
"
vt.
【地质学;地理学】使(一个地块)架叠于另一地块之上,上推。
Similar Words:
"obdradovic" English translation
,
"obdrzalek" English translation
,
"obduce" English translation
,
"obducens" English translation
,
"obducent" English translation
,
"obducted sheet" English translation
,
"obductio late" English translation
,
"obduction" English translation
,
"obduction orogen belts" English translation
,
"obduction plate" English translation